The thing to do in health tech this week? Trademark infringement. Today on Health in 2 Point 00, we try to make sense of all the lawsuits right now with Teladoc suing Amwell, Allscripts suing CarePortMD, and whose side are we on for Zocdoc suing Zocdoc? On Episode 160, Jess asks me to make sense of Augmedix’s faux IPO in a reverse merger and publicly traded company Newtopia arising $ 75 million. Twentyeight Health raises $ 5.1 million in a Series C and TestCard raises $ 5.8 million for at-home mobile urine testing. —Matthew Holt
